Author: Jules Janin Title: Diable Boiteux Par le Sage
Description: Paris, Ernest Bourdin et Cie, 1840. Leather. An illustrated edition of this scarce work from Jules Janin, in the original French language. French language. Scarce work. A retelling of "The Lame Devil," set in Madrid, which follows the demon king Asmodeus, Don Cleophas Leandro Perez Zambullo, and his beloved Donna Thomasa. With a note to the original author, Alain-Rene Lesage, a French novelist and playwright. Written by Jules Janin, a French writer and critic. Illustrated by Antoine "Tony" Johannot, a French engraver, painter, and illustrator. In the original half crushed morocoo with brown cloth boards. Externally, sound with front board detached. Loss to the head of the spine and bumping to the extremities. The odd mark to the board. Internally, firmly bound. Pages are bright with light scattered spotting. Good Only . Ill.: Tony Johannot.
